    Yeah, I've been looking at those CAG demand charts for min sands for years. Funny thing is global production never grows to match demand predictions. Not that demand at lower prices is not present...

    The classical economic relationship between demand-supply-price is a good place to start. Beyond minor ST swing changes of inventories (suppliers and consumers) consumption can only equal supply. Demand then drives the price higher or lower to 'clear' the market. Underlying demand rises and falls inversely with price due to affordability and substitution etc. What I see looking back is a fairly steady supply of min sand products, +/- periods of growth, with price being the clearing variable to match that supply with demand. Take this July 2022 TZMI zircon supply chart going back to 2010 (from Astron, ASX:ATR).
    https://hotcopper.com.au/data/attachments/4691/4691167-b52e605d8aa8f47fca66e6528a52db55.jpg

    Supply has bounced along and off a top of 1200tpa for the past decade, ipso facto zircon demand/consumption is matched +/- inventory changes. The price of zircon (and other min sand products) has oscillated significantly over that period to clear the market, espcially since the post GFC, Chinese driven commodity boom in 2011-12.
    https://hotcopper.com.au/data/attachments/4691/4691187-0058fae2a4f3c6a0765c8f6998de4ba1.jpg

    TZMI are the experts, though they do get paid by clients for opinions and businesses are generally supportive of their clients. You will notice the above zircon supply chart does not predict what new supply is coming on, just how supply is falling from existing mines ex-new supply. Same chart STA. SFX and all the rest like roll out but a bit misleading don;t you think? Surely new supply is what it's all about ...
